Make your life easier with rough carpentry estimating & takeoff software from eTakeoff. Performing a rough carpentry estimate has many challenges. Not only are there endless components to takeoff such as structural wood, sheathing, joists, paneling, etc., but developing an accurate material list will make or break a job at the end of the day. For example, calculating the number of joists per size and length at the estimating stage will save on waisted lumber during the job and win your company more bids.eTakeoff Dimension gives you various tools for different types of takeoff. Using the joist extension tool, for example, you can easily measure an area, enter in the size and spacing of the joists and the program will calculate and display a series of parallel members inside the measurement. You can also move and rotate the joist layout for more accuracy. The result will give you a list of counts and lengths for the joists needed on the job. Calculate and lays out joists

Joist extensions offer special powerful features. The area to be covered is digitized. The joist spacing and joist width are entered. The length rounding is selected from a list. A pitch can be specified for sloped joists such as roofs. You can then:

  • Rotate the joist orientation to any angle
  • Move the starting point for the first joist
  • Remove or insert individual joists
  • Double up individual joists

The joist layout is visually displayed. You can also get a count of the different lengths needed and copy it to the clipboard.

Calculate framing and drywall from one measurement

A simple extension in eTakeoff’s rough carpentry estimating & takeoff software calculates the track distance, stud count and drywall sheet count from a single measurement. The wall is digitized in a plan view. The wall height, stud spacing and drywall sides are entered. The drywall sheet size is selected from a list. Track distance, stud count, drywall square feet and drywall sheet count are calculated.
